WebMar 22, 2024 · Paragraph 18.4.5.3.2 states that the required fire flow for buildings other than one and two family dwellings can be reduced by 75 percent when the building is protected by an approved automatic sprinkler system. However, the resulting fire flow cannot be less than 1000 gpm (3785 L/min) or 600 gpm (2270 L/min) where quick … http://www.yearbook2024.psg.fr/D59FC9C/BMAu_pollard-water-flow-test-chart-calculator.pdf budapest food guide https://mixtuneforcully.com

http://www.pnws-awwa.org/uploads/PDFs/conferences/2015/Technical%20Sessions/Thursday/1_Recommended%20Procedures%20and%20Use%20of%20Fire%20Hydrant%20Flow%20Tests.pdf WebThe volume flow rate Q Q of a fluid is defined to be the volume of fluid that is passing through a given cross sectional area per unit time. The term cross sectional area is just a fancy term often used to describe the area through which something is flowing, e.g., the circular area inside the dashed line in the diagram below.

WebOct 28, 2024 · Peak expiratory flow (PEF, or peak expiratory flow ratio - PEFR) is the maximum speed of air during expiration. The speed depends on three basic parameters: lung volume, strength of the respiratory muscles, and the bronchial diameter. As the volume of the lungs remains almost the same for the entirety of adult life, and the respiratory …
